A highly placed source in ODM claims President Uhuru Kenyatta secretly held closed-door meeting with former Prime Minister Raila Odinga in State House Mombasa yet again.

In July last year, the two leaders, in presence of Mombasa governor Hassan Joho, met at Vipingo Ridge where they held closed-door discussions whose details remain scanty.

And on Thursday night, the source who spoke in confidence says, Raila met the president for three hours from 9pm and discussed a raft of issues.

"I don't know what they discussed but I can assure you that they met for around three hours. They were alone at State House but such meetings are common nowadays.

"To be honest, I can't comment in cabinet reshuffle because I wasn't in that meeting. Though, I don't see the reason why that should worry anybody because ODM is supporting Big Four agenda," he said.

Earlier, Raila had landed directly from South Africa at Mombasa after ending his holiday at Windhok, Namibia. His decision to land at the coast directly has sparked speculations about an impending cabinet reshuffle.

A source within Deputy President campaign team also hinted that Uhuru summoned all Cabinet Secretaries to Mombasa and they are expected to comply with the directive on Friday (today).

During his interview with reporters in December, Uhuru lauded the Handshake with Raila Odinga, insisting that it had helped him restore order in government.

"The unity has helped me to deal with cartels who hide in their communities. We shall continue in that trend and that is the way to go," he said.
